    Ask for CP 1 or CP 2 filler rod. CP Ti is unigue as filler rod is no different than the base metal.

    Better yet get a small square of .020 CP 2 sheet combined with enough .063 or .083 dia filler to meet a $50 minimum order and your set for a long time.
